Q.: List all the names of the core Team Members, along with their Designated Roles – How you see them evolving over time. What would be each of their Skill Sets? – Elaborate also if any of the team members has a specific domain expertise.
Ans:
We have commissioned/project basis recruitments for managing patent drafting from different domains with domain expertise and interns for intellectual property related hearing and administrative issues. To reduce excessive dependence on interns for administrative work, Intellexsys has designed a mobile application and an automated standard format document generation system online with app-based invoicing to keep it simple and quick. Any customer can download the APP to view the current status of all the applications filed in their name which has streamlined my processes with regards to sending e-mails/SMS for constant changes in the status of an application. Further, a link which is available on my website upon request allows customers to create drafts of standard process related document within a few seconds by filling a small form to execute with pre-defined instructions. This keeps the management of work efficient. 

Q.: Tell us about the Product / Solution. How did you get your first customer? Explain how you went about the Product-Market Fit Process.
Ans:
Our solution is unmarketable. Lawyers cannot advertise their services and thus, a strong recommendation by a trusted person got us our first client! However, we have extended information through various social mediums using infographics, videos, webinars, seminars and so on to spread the word on IP.

Q.: Since inception, give us a sense of the value of business done by your venture? Please explain in detail. (e.g., What is the current turnover? From Launching till date total no. of visitors on website/persons registered/enquiries and enrollment etc.)
Ans:
We have completed over 900+ projects having worked with celebrities, singers, manufacturers, MNC’s for their IP requirements. Leads are generated through client references. These references have resulted in tier-2 and further references with business having initiated with approximately INR 5 Lakhs in the first year to an annual gross turnover of approximately INR 30 Lakhs in the previous year!

Q.: What is the big picture of your startup? Is this Product/service leading to something bigger? If so, how?
Ans:
The bigger picture is to spread awareness of intellectual property rights and its understanding amongst start-ups, companies, inventors, authors, etc. in the right manner. Lack of correct knowledge or half-knowledge is dangerous and can lead to many unwanted and unnecessary litigation resulting in lost time, effort and money which is no less than a hazard for anyone involved.

This is being achieved by conducting free programs under the banner “What’s the big deal about Intellectual Property Rights” and “Get Legit” for start-ups at co-working spaces, NGO’s, businessmen at Rotary Club meetings and as a part of business coaching workshops. We have conducted 6 workshops catering to 200+ persons interested. Further, Intellexsys creates infographics, animated videos sharing IP knowledge on our YouTube, LinkedIn and Instagram handles; undertakes game stalls for equipping people with IP knowledge during the World Intellectual Property Week and having conducted a webinar on IP and innovation, footage available on YouTube.

Q.: Who do You Perceive as Your Competition? How do you differentiate yourself with them?
Ans:
Online quick-filing options available at reduced prices with automated search engines being heavily funded and promoted have hit the IP filing segment. However, specialized and case-to-case basis consultation being of prime importance owing to the fact that the filing procedure is only one of the requisites for obtaining IP registration and enforcing it. Subject-matter expertise is the choice of our target clientele.
